Experience the Iconic Gateway Arch
What is the ideal way to genuinely capture the spirit of St. Louis? The Gateway Arch stands as a grand symbol of the city, representing both its profound history and lively future. Stretching at 630 feet, this stainless steel masterpiece is the tallest arch in the world and gives breathtaking views of the Mississippi River and downtown St. Louis. Visitors can start a unique tram ride to the top, which provides a rare perspective on the city's expansive skyline.
The Gateway Arch National Park, located beside the arch, invites discovery with beautifully landscaped grounds, reflecting pools, and informative displays. The site honors the western growth of the United States, making it a important historical landmark. At sunset, the arch glows with a amber glow, enchanting visitors and producing an memorable visual experience. Ultimately, the Gateway Arch serves as a gateway not only to the city but to the stories that formed a nation.

Enjoy Delicious Local Cuisine
St. Louis is well-known for its eclectic and savory local cooking, making it a food lover's paradise for visitors. The city's premier offering, toasted ravioli, provides a crispy rendition on orthodox pasta, frequently served with marinara sauce. Visitors can also experience St. Louis-style barbecue, characterized by its unique tomato-based sauce, which improves smoked meats such as ribs and brisket.
Moreover, famous St. Louis-style pizza displays a thin, cracker-like crust topped with Provel cheese, imparting a distinctive flavor that makes it unique from other regional pizzas. The city's culinary scene is elevated by its rich German heritage, evident in dishes like gooey butter cake, a sweet dessert that captivates locals and tourists alike.
From culinary events to charming eateries, St. Louis welcomes culinary lovers to enjoy its local flavors, ensuring that every meal becomes a memorable part of their visit.

Enjoy Family-focused Attractions
Guests visiting St. Louis will discover a wealth of destinations designed to captivate individuals of all ages. The celebrated St. Louis Zoo presents gratis entry, facilitating children to explore its diverse animal exhibits and savor fascinating educational programs. The adjacent Missouri Botanical Garden provides a peaceful environment with magnificent landscapes, perfect for family excursions and picnics.
For a portion of science, the St. Louis Science Center captivates young minds with dynamic displays and an OMNIMAX theater. Families can also experience the thrill of the City Museum, an eclectic playground featuring slides, tunnels, and climbing structures crafted from repurposed architectural elements.
Furthermore, the Magic House, St. Louis Children's Museum welcomes hands-on exploration, encouraging imagination and wonder among its young visitors. With a variety of activities that cater to various interests, St. Louis stands out as a family-friendly destination filled with adventure and excitement.

Are there any public transportation choices available in St. Louis?
St. Louis supplies many public transportation systems, containing MetroLink light rail, buses, and bike-sharing initiatives. These services grant accessible pathways to popular attractions, making it simpler for visitors to traverse the city with ease.
